Willow Vale - Pimpama (West) · Statistical Area 2 (SA2)
What people believe — religious affiliation and those with no religion.
Over half of the people in Willow Vale - Pimpama (West) report having no religion. This represents a significant shift away from traditional faith, with 50.1% of residents identifying as non-religious, a figure far above the national average.
The mix of religions, and people with no religion.
The 50.1% who claim no religion is well above the Queensland figure of 41.2% and far above the 38.9% seen across Australia. Other common affiliations include Christianity at 37.6%, Buddhism at 1.4%, and Hinduism at 1.0%.
